I reviewed Struts internally and discovered that in all places it uses "1.0.2" instead of "1.0.3". So, I guessed if I rewrite my DOCTYPE to:

<!DOCTYPE validators PUBLIC "-//Apache Struts//XWork Validator 1.0.2//EN" "http://struts.apache.org/dtds/xwork-validator-1.0.2.dtd";>

it may work. I tried and yeah, it works!

(However, it's some was confusing that "xwork-validator-1.0.3.dtd" is present in "xwork.jar" but we cannot use it "*offline*" until Struts also use it internally)

Hi there,

We have a Struts2 application with some validation XMLs with following
"DOCTYPE":

    <!DOCTYPE validators PUBLIC "-//Apache Struts//XWork Validator
    1.0.3//EN" "http://struts.apache.org/dtds/xwork-validator-1.0.3.dtd";>


When we run this application on a server which has access to
"struts.apache.org", there is no problem. But when we run it on a server
which has no access to "struts.apache.org", Struts can not create default
validation interceptor with following exception:

    Caught Exception while registering Interceptor class
    org.apache.struts2.interceptor.validation.AnnotationValidationInterceptor
    - interceptor -

jar:file:/home/yasser/Applications/apache-tomcat-7.0.29/webapps/TAAM/WEB-INF/lib/struts2-core-2.3.1.1.jar!/struts-default.xml:148:127
